Enrolling at our school

WebPartZone1_1
PublishingPageContent

​​​​​Enrolling at Maroochydore State High School is an important and exciting process and we welcome all our new students.  Due to our enrolment capacity however, we are a catchment managed school and can only accept students who reside within the school's catchment area.

How to enrol

  1. Enrolment eligibility and application
  2. Important policies to read and understand
  3. Enrolment interview

The following information is important to note for parent/carers who would like to enrol their student/s at Maroochydore State High School.

Enrolment interviews are conducted Thursday mornings to commence school the following Monday. Parents will also need to organise stationery, technology items, uniforms and other school requirements before their student begins.

If you are interested in a school tour, please contact the office to arrange an appointment.

International students are welcomed and are managed through Education Queensland International. Our International Coordinator can support you with this process.

Step 1 - Eligibility for enrolment

  • Check the enrolment catchment map online via EdMap to find your home street address. The Principal will verify that your listed residential address is within the enrolment boundary.
  • Complete an enrolment application form for each student by:
    • Completing the MSHS Enrolment Application and email to our Enrolments Officer emp@maroochydoreshs.eq.edu.au
    • Downloading and printing the  ​and submitting to our Enrolment officer in person or mail to PO Box 55 Maroochydore 4558
    • Visiting our Office in person to collect an enrolment application pack

You will need to provide certain documents for our Enrolment Officer to sight before the enrolment interview. These need to be included with your application. Please be prepared, without the correct and completed documents the enrolment interview cannot proceed.

Please provide the following items:

  • each child’s birth certificate
  • each child’s passport visa and parent’s passport visas (for overseas applicants)
  • your proof of residency
    • owners – rates notice and water or electricity bill
    • renters – lease agreement and water or electricity bill
  • each child’s most recent student report card (two preferred)

Email the completed application and other necessary documentation to our Enrolment Officer or post to: Maroochydore State High School, PO Box 55, Maroochydore Qld 4558.

Upon receipt, the Enrolment Officer will contact you to arrange an enrolment interview with the Deputy Principal.
Please note:  Future Year 7 in catchment enrolments for the following academic year are due by the end of Term 2.  This will ensure your child’s invitation to the Term 3 Orientation Program.

Out-of-catchment application

If you are out of catchment but would still like to be considered for enrolment at due to special circumstances, complete an Out of catchment form and address your email to the Principal via the Enrolment Officer along with your two most recent school reports and other supporting documentation. 

Please read the Enrolment Management Plan for information about 'out of catchment' enrolments before proceeding with an 'out of catchment' application.

Step 3 – Enrolment interview

An enrolment interview is a mandatory part of the enrolment process as it allows staff to become familiar with the aspirations and needs of individual students.  It also ensures each student has a clear understanding of school expectations and gives families the opportunity to ask specific questions relevant to their student. 

For senior students, enrolment interviews are a minimum of 30 minutes to allow enough time for career pathway and subject discussion. To investigate 'alternative to school' pathways, contact the office to arrange an appointment with a Guidance Officer or careers advisor.
